School Highlights
Arizona College-Mesa serves 481 students (100% of students are full-time).
Minority enrollment is 79%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the state average of 61%.

Student Body
The student population of Arizona College-Mesa has declined by 16% over five years.
The Arizona College-Mesa diversity score of 0.74 is more than the state average of 0.71.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five years.
